A practical guide to Wolf Precision's Level 1–3 builds, Gen-4 ACE with BAT actions, and the new prosumer gunsmithing path. In Episode 251, Jamie Dodson breaks down Wolf Precision's new three-level path for owning a custom ACE-based rifle—designed to save you money, build real skills, and put world-class performance in your hands. Level 1 (Core Kit): all core components minus the trigger, with training to assemble, maintain, and swap calibers/barrels yourself. Level 2 (Assembled Minus One): a fully assembled rifle minus the trigger (two pins and done), perfect for first-timers who want a correct baseline before learning maintenance. Level 3 (Range-Ready): a complete Wolf Precision custom rifle—optics mounted, zeroed, and ready to perform. Jamie explains why we pair the Gen-4 ACE with BAT Machine receivers (Igniter, VR, TR, Bumblebee, Vampire, Vesper, and more): consistency, perfect headspace, and true repeatability. You'll also hear about the upcoming Prosumer Gunsmithing School (online and in-person Armory sessions), live ACE install demos planned for SHOT Show 2026 and the Great American Outdoor Show, and why paying $10–15K for a rifle isn't a prerequisite for excellence. Episode 249: The Forever Barrel — Fact or Fiction? In this episode of the Long Range Shooting and Custom Rifle Building Podcast, Jamie Dodson dives into one of the most exciting developments for 2026 — the concept of the Forever Barrel. With the launch of the Gen-4 ACE system, Wolf Precision explores how precision chambering and modern machining can extend a barrel's usable life two to three times longer than traditional setups. Jamie breaks down the science of throat wear, why traditional "set-back" chambering often fails, and how separating the chamber from the barrel changes everything. He also discusses long-term savings for competitive shooters, the future of match and hunting barrels, and the new Prosumer Gunsmithing School that will teach shooters how to do it themselves. In this episode, we're pulling back the curtain on a long-standing myth in the American hunting community: that 1 MOA equals 1 inch at 100 yards. Spoiler alert—it doesn't. Jamie Dodson walks you through the real math behind minutes and mils, compares their pros and cons, and explains why the "language of hunters" might be more marketing than fact. We're diving deep into how rounding MOA values distorts your accuracy, why mils are faster, cleaner, and more honest, and why most of the world—and long-range shooters—prefer them. If you've ever been told that minutes are "simple" or "easier," this episode might change the way you shoot forever.
